How much should Gears cost?
I am planning on installing FRPP 3:73 in my Automatic GT is that good? I drive Highway and another thing i dont like that im a worried about is it true that my gears driving up my RPM's up higher at cruise and Acceleration? Explain is this harder on my engine? And how much should the install cost me ?

RE: How much should Gears cost?
If you do a fair amount of Freeway drving then 3.73s were prob a good choice since you are auto. Your Rpms will be slightly higher on the freeway but not a whole lot. Its really no harder on the engine and may actually be a little less stress on it around the city.
You will definately notice an increase in performance and acceleration.

RE: How much should Gears cost?
not any worse on your engine than stock. gas milage is not effected...well, it is (very little)...most say about 1-2 mpg if you're conservative. Most people aren't however, because they like to feel the "pull." gears will be between 150-225 depending on purchaser, and install will run between 180-275 depending on who you go to.

RE: How much should Gears cost?
My gear installation ran around 200 and then 200 for the gears for a whopping grand total of $400. So any where around there is reasonable. 3.73's are a good choice if you drive the freeway (sry highway) a lot. texan here
